Rex Rattus left this review about The Great Northern Railway Tavern
No real ale on, nor any handpumps offering the possibility of something decent to drink on some future occasion. There are some original features in this Victorian ex-gin palace, but there are no other redeeming features as far as I can see. But, because I needed something to eat I decided to have a half of Stella and a Thai lunch. Got the Stella OK but there didn't seem to be a way to get something to eat other than trying to snag the chef as he hurtled to and from the kitchen with other people's meals. It seems the bar staff play absolutely no part in the food process – it's like having two businesses on the same premises. I suppose that's the way it is now, but losing business because a hungry punter can't get something to eat in a pretty empty pub can't be good for business. I won't be coming back.
